What service do you need
Location
Use My Location
Log In
Sign Up
Find Pros
Log In
Sign Up
Home
NH
Merrimack
Computer Repair
Computer Technical Support
Technicraft Inc
Gallery
Technicraft Inc
49 Depot St, Merrimack, NH 03054
Computer Technical Assistance & Support Services, Computer Network Design & Systems, Computer System Designers & Consultants
Gallery
(1)